The Three Systems Requiring Maintenance
1. Hydraulic System — Controls chair movement (raise, lower, tilt, recline)
2. Upholstery & Surfaces — Patient contact areas requiring infection control
3. Electrical System — Motors, controls, foot switches, integrated delivery
Understanding Hydraulic Systems
Most dental chairs use hydraulic systems to manage positioning. Understanding how they work helps you maintain them properly.
How Dental Chair Hydraulics Work
| Component | Function | Failure Symptoms |
|---|---|---|
| Hydraulic pump | Generates pressure to move oil | Chair won’t lift, slow movement |
| Cylinders | Convert oil pressure to movement | Jerky motion, sinking when stationary |
| Control valves | Direct oil flow to cylinders | Specific movements fail |
| Reservoir | Stores hydraulic fluid | Low pressure, air in system |
| Seals & hoses | Contain pressurized fluid | Visible leaks, pressure loss |
Optimal hydraulic pressure: 0.6-0.8 MPa (87-116 psi)
Key Stat: Hydraulic seal failures account for 45% of dental chair repairs. Monthly pressure checks and quarterly seal inspections prevent most failures.
Signs of Hydraulic Problems
Watch for these warning signs during daily operation:
| Symptom | Likely Cause | Urgency |
|---|---|---|
| Chair sinks slowly when stationary | Seal leak, cylinder wear | Schedule service |
| Jerky or stuttering movement | Air in system, low fluid | Service within 1 week |
| Chair won’t lift fully | Low pressure, pump wear | Service within 1 week |
| Whining/grinding noise during movement | Low fluid, pump damage | Service immediately |
| Visible oil under chair base | Active leak | Service immediately |
| Slow response to controls | Valve issues, low pressure | Schedule service |
Daily Maintenance Checklist (5-10 Minutes)
Daily tasks maintain infection control and catch problems early.
Movement & Function Check
- Raise and lower chair through full range of motion
- Test tilt and recline functions
- Listen for unusual sounds (whining, grinding, stuttering)
- Note any hesitation or jerky movements
- Verify foot control responsiveness
Visual Inspection
- Check chair base for oil spots or leaks
- Inspect upholstery for tears, cracks, or damage
- Examine headrest articulation and stability
- Verify armrests lock securely
- Check delivery system attachment points
Surface Disinfection
| Surface | Cleaning Protocol |
|---|---|
| Headrest | Disinfectant wipe, allow to air dry |
| Seat cushion | Disinfectant wipe, barrier cover if used |
| Armrests | Disinfectant wipe, including undersides |
| Back cushion | Disinfectant wipe entire surface |
| Base/frame | Damp cloth, disinfectant if contaminated |
| Controls | Disinfectant wipe, avoid excess moisture |
Compliance Alert: OSHA requires disinfection of all patient contact surfaces between patients. Document your cleaning protocol and ensure all staff are trained.
End-of-Day Tasks
- Wipe all surfaces with clean damp cloth to remove chemical residue
- Return chair to neutral position
- Cover chair if practice protocols require
- Note any issues in maintenance log
Weekly Maintenance Checklist (15-20 Minutes)
Weekly tasks address components that need regular attention.
Lubrication
- Lubricate headrest pivot points (if manufacturer recommends)
- Apply lubricant to armrest hinges
- Lubricate track mechanisms (tilt/recline)
- Check articulating joint movement
Use only manufacturer-approved lubricants. Wrong lubricant types can damage seals and void warranties.
Detailed Inspection
- Examine upholstery seams for separation or wear
- Check all electrical cords for damage
- Inspect foot control cable integrity
- Test all programmable positions
- Verify integrated delivery system functions
Cleaning
- Deep clean crevices and seams (cotton swab or soft brush)
- Clean track areas where debris accumulates
- Wipe base thoroughly
- Clean foot control pedal and surrounding area
Monthly Maintenance Checklist (30-45 Minutes)
Monthly tasks catch developing issues and maintain optimal performance.
Hydraulic System Inspection
| Task | Procedure | What to Look For |
|---|---|---|
| Pressure check | Cycle through all movements | Consistent speed, full range |
| Leak inspection | Examine all hoses and connections | Oil residue, wet spots |
| Fluid level | Check reservoir (if accessible) | Proper level per manual |
| Seal inspection | Visual check of cylinder seals | Cracking, hardening, weeping |
Full Function Testing
- Test every programmed position
- Verify smooth transitions between positions
- Check emergency manual controls (if equipped)
- Test integrated systems (light, delivery)
- Confirm all safety interlocks function
Upholstery Deep Cleaning
Standard cleaning protocol:
- Remove any barrier covers
- Wipe with warm soapy water using soft cloth
- Clean seams and crevices with soft brush
- Rinse with clean damp cloth
- Dry completely before use
- Apply vinyl protectant (if recommended by manufacturer)
For contaminated upholstery (blood, body fluids):
- Wipe visible contamination with disposable towel
- Apply EPA-approved disinfectant per label directions
- Allow proper contact time
- Wipe with clean water to remove residue
- Dry thoroughly
ChairPulse Insight: Performance data shows vinyl upholstery cleaned only with harsh disinfectants lasts 2.7 years on average. Vinyl cleaned with soap/water and disinfectant only when needed lasts 5+ years. Premium nano-coated materials last 8+ years with proper care.
Electrical System Check
- Inspect all electrical connections for security
- Check foot control operation and responsiveness
- Test integrated light functions
- Verify control panel operates correctly
- Look for frayed wires or damaged insulation
Quarterly Maintenance (Professional Recommended)
Quarterly maintenance benefits from professional expertise.
Professional Inspection Tasks
| System | Professional Tasks | Typical Cost |
|---|---|---|
| Hydraulics | Pressure testing, seal assessment, fluid analysis | $150-250 |
| Electrical | Motor amp draw, control board diagnostics | $100-200 |
| Mechanical | Bearing inspection, alignment check | $100-150 |
| Complete | All systems, written report | $250-400 |
In-House Quarterly Tasks
- Review all maintenance logs for the quarter
- Analyze any patterns in issues or concerns
- Assess upholstery condition and plan for replacement if needed
- Verify all daily/weekly tasks are being completed
- Update maintenance schedule based on findings
Annual Maintenance (Professional Required)
Annual maintenance should include comprehensive professional service.
Annual Professional Service Includes
| Task | Purpose | Prevents |
|---|---|---|
| Complete hydraulic service | Verify pressure, check all seals | Major hydraulic failures |
| Fluid replacement | Remove contamination, restore viscosity | Pump and valve damage |
| Electrical testing | Load test motors, check controls | Electrical failures |
| Safety inspection | Verify interlocks, emergency functions | Safety hazards |
| Calibration | Adjust positions, verify accuracy | Positioning issues |
| Wear assessment | Identify components needing replacement | Unexpected failures |
Typical annual service cost: $400-700 per chair
Cost Savings: Annual professional maintenance costs $400-700 but prevents emergency repairs averaging $1,500-4,000. The ROI is 3-5x in the first year alone.
When to Schedule Annual Service
- Before warranty expires (document compliance)
- At the start of each calendar year
- Before busy seasons (insurance deadline rushes)
- After any extended period of non-use
Upholstery Care Best Practices
Upholstery is the most visible maintenance issue and affects patient perception.
Daily Upholstery Protocol
| Step | Products | Technique |
|---|---|---|
| 1. Remove debris | Disposable towel | Wipe visible contamination |
| 2. Clean | Warm soapy water | Soft cloth, gentle pressure |
| 3. Disinfect (if needed) | EPA-approved, non-chlorine | Per label directions |
| 4. Remove residue | Clean water | Wipe thoroughly |
| 5. Dry | Air dry or soft cloth | Complete drying before use |
Products to Avoid
| Product Type | Why It Damages Upholstery |
|---|---|
| Chlorine-based cleaners | Degrades vinyl and silicone seals |
| Undiluted alcohol | Causes vinyl cracking over time |
| Abrasive scrubbers | Scratches protective coating |
| Petroleum-based products | Softens vinyl, attracts dirt |
| Spray cleaners | Overspray damages other components |
Extending Upholstery Life
- Use barrier covers when appropriate
- Clean spills immediately
- Avoid sitting on armrests
- Keep sharp objects away from surfaces
- Maintain climate control (extreme temps damage vinyl)
- Apply vinyl conditioner monthly (if manufacturer approved)
When to Repair vs. Replace
Use this framework to make repair/replace decisions.
Repair When:
- Chair is less than 10 years old
- Issue is isolated to one system
- Parts are readily available
- Repair cost is less than 15% of replacement value
- Chair meets current infection control standards
Replace When:
- Annual repair costs exceed 15-20% of replacement value
- Chair is over 15 years old with recurring issues
- Parts are no longer available
- Multiple systems failing simultaneously
- Chair doesn’t meet current standards
- Repair quote exceeds 40% of replacement cost
Cost Comparison Example
| Scenario | Repair Cost | Replace Cost | Recommendation |
|---|---|---|---|
| 5-year chair, single hydraulic issue | $1,200 | $15,000 | Repair (8% of replacement) |
| 12-year chair, multiple issues | $3,500 | $15,000 | Consider replacement (23%) |
| 18-year chair, hydraulic failure | $2,500 | $15,000 | Replace (age + diminishing returns) |
Common Maintenance Mistakes
Avoid these frequently observed maintenance errors:
Hydraulic System Mistakes
| Mistake | Consequence | Prevention |
|---|---|---|
| Ignoring slow movement | Pump wear accelerates | Service at first signs |
| Using wrong hydraulic fluid | Seal damage, system failure | Use manufacturer-specified only |
| Ignoring small leaks | Major failure eventually | Address all leaks immediately |
| Skipping quarterly checks | Problems develop unnoticed | Schedule professional inspections |
Upholstery Mistakes
| Mistake | Consequence | Prevention |
|---|---|---|
| Daily alcohol cleaning | Vinyl cracking within 2-3 years | Soap/water primary, disinfectant when needed |
| Leaving spills | Permanent staining | Immediate cleanup |
| Using abrasives | Surface damage | Soft cloths only |
| Ignoring small tears | Tears expand, compliance issues | Repair or replace promptly |
General Mistakes
| Mistake | Consequence | Prevention |
|---|---|---|
| No documentation | Can’t track patterns, compliance risk | Log everything |
| Skipping daily checks | Problems caught late | Build into opening routine |
| Reactive-only approach | Higher costs, more downtime | Implement preventive schedule |
| DIY repairs on electrical/hydraulic | Safety hazards, voided warranty | Use qualified professionals |
Documentation Requirements
Proper documentation protects your practice and improves care.
What to Document
| Element | Example |
|---|---|
| Date and time | 01/25/2026, 7:45 AM |
| Equipment ID | Chair 1, Serial #12345 |
| Tasks performed | Daily inspection, surface disinfection |
| Issues found | Small tear in headrest noted |
| Actions taken | Scheduled repair, applied temporary patch |
| Operator | Jane D. |
| Next service | Weekly maintenance 01/31/2026 |
Retention Requirements
- Maintenance logs: 3 years minimum
- Professional service records: Life of equipment
- Warranty documentation: Life of equipment
- Repair invoices: 7 years (tax purposes)

Frequently Asked Questions
How long should a dental chair last?
A well-maintained dental chair should last 15-20 years. Practices with structured maintenance programs report average lifespans of 15+ years, while chairs with minimal maintenance typically fail within 7-10 years. Hydraulic systems are usually the limiting factor, with proper care extending their life significantly.
How often should dental chair hydraulics be serviced?
Check hydraulic function daily by cycling the chair through its full range of motion. Monthly, inspect for leaks and verify pressure (optimal: 0.6-0.8 MPa). Quarterly, have a professional inspect seals and fluid levels. Annual professional service should include pressure testing and potential fluid replacement if contaminated.
What should I use to clean dental chair upholstery?
Clean dental chair upholstery daily with warm soapy water and a soft cloth. For disinfection after contamination, use EPA-approved, non-chlorine-based disinfectants. Avoid alcohol-based cleaners as primary cleaners—repeated use causes vinyl cracking. If alcohol is used for disinfection, wipe with soapy water afterward to remove residue.
